CreditRiskMonitor 2013 Operating Results
Marketwire - Fri Mar 07, 7:01AM CST
CreditRiskMonitor (OTCQX: CRMZ) reported that for the year ended December 31, 2013 revenues increased 7% to $11.84 million compared to fiscal 2012, while income from operations was $0.62 million versus $0.97 million in the prior year. Cash, cash equivalents and marketable securities at the end of 2013 decreased to $8.05 million from the 2012 year-end balance of $8.15 million.
CreditRiskMonitor Announces 3Q Results
Marketwire - Fri Nov 01, 5:01AM CDT
CreditRiskMonitor (OTCQX: CRMZ) reported that revenues were $3.01 million and $8.81 million for the 3 and 9 months ended September 30, 2013, respectively, an increase of 7% over the comparable periods last year. For the same periods, income from operations was $313,800 and $482,100, respectively, compared to $442,200 and $724,400 for the comparable 2012 periods. Cash, cash equivalents and marketable securities at the end of the nine-month period increased $506,000 to $8.66 million versus the 2012 year-end balance of $8.15 million.
CreditRiskMonitor Declares Special Dividend
Marketwire - Tue Oct 22, 1:53PM CDT
CreditRiskMonitor (OTCQX: CRMZ) announced that its Board of Directors has declared a special dividend of $0.05 per outstanding share of its common stock. The dividend will be payable on November 22, 2013 to shareholders of record of the Corporation at the close of business on November 7, 2013.
CreditRiskMonitor Announces 2012 Operating Results
Marketwire - Thu Mar 14, 11:55AM CDT
CreditRiskMonitor (OTCQX: CRMZ) reported that for the year ended December 31, 2012 revenues increased 9% to $11.06 million compared to fiscal 2011, while income from operations was $0.97 million versus $1.21 million in the prior year. Cash, cash equivalents and marketable securities at the end of 2012 decreased $0.14 million, after the payment of a cash dividend of $1.59 million in the fourth quarter of 2012, to $8.15 million from the 2011 year-end balance of $8.28 million.
